Optical fibers are revolutionizing the way we communicate by providing a means of transmitting information over long distances at high bit rates. They offer numerous advantages, including immunity to electromagnetic interference, high security due to their dielectric nature, and a smaller diameter than traditional cables.
The principle behind the operation of optical fibers is based on the refraction of light. The fiber is made up of several layers of dielectric material, which can be either glass or plastic, that have different indices of refraction. The light is confined to the center of the fiber, allowing for transmission through a transparent medium.
Optical fibers are made up of three main components: the core, the cladding, and the coating. The core is made of doped silica, surrounded by natural silica, and the light signal propagates along it. The signal is reflected on the surface between the core and the coating. The acrylic coating, which usually consists of two layers, protects the silica from abrasion during installation.
There are different types of optical fibers, including multimode, single mode, step-index multimode, and gradient index multimode. Step-index multimode is the most common fiber and is used in LAN-type local networks. It has a very large core, and the attenuation on this type of fiber is high due to the difference in refractive index between the core and the optical cladding. Gradient index multimode fiber is also used in local area networks and has a core of intermediate size. The attenuation on this type of fiber is lower than on step-index fibers. Single-mode fiber is the best existing fiber and is used in the cores of global networks. It offers much higher throughput than multimode fiber and has a very thin core, the size of a hair.
The use of optical fibers has numerous applications beyond telecommunications. Optical fibers are used in temperature sensors, medical imaging, and lighting. In telecommunications, optical fibers are used for the transmission of information, including telephone conversations, images, and data. Fiber optic cables transmit large amounts of data at very high speeds, and thanks to multiplexing, hundreds of gigabits per second can be achieved.
Fiber optics is also revolutionizing internet access by providing much faster speeds than traditional copper wires. With fiber optic cables, data can be transmitted at speeds of up to 10 Gbps. Compared to traditional copper wires, fiber optic cables are less bulky, lighter, more flexible, and carry more data.
In addition to telecommunications and internet access, fiber optics is also used in television. The use of fiber optics has enabled the transmission of high-quality images and sound without interference.
